Delhi Capitals Questioned Over Prithvi Shaw Snub Despite Repeated Setbacks

In a disappointing outing for the Delhi Capitals (DC), the team faced a significant defeat against the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) on Monday, losing by nine wickets. The match highlighted a glaring issue in DC's top-order batting, leading former cricketer Irfan Pathan to question the franchise's decision to snub Prithvi Shaw, a player known for his explosive batting capabilities. Shaw's absence from the playing XI has sparked discussions among analysts and fans alike regarding the team's strategy and selection process. The match against RCB saw DC's batting lineup struggle, with key players failing to deliver under pressure. The top-order collapse left the team vulnerable, and they could only muster a meager total that was swiftly chased down by RCB. Pathan's comments resonate with many who believe that Shaw's inclusion could have provided the much-needed firepower and stability at the top of the order. Despite facing several setbacks in recent matches, the decision to bench Shaw raises questions about team management and player form evaluation.
